The Art of Creating Calm

Olivia Dean’s latest single, "Float," from her second studio album, The Art of Loving (2025), showcases a lush soundscape that is both soothing and introspective. Produced by Zach Nahome, the track captures a sense of tranquility that invites listeners to immerse themselves in a world where worries fade away like ripples on water.

The serene imagery in "Float" is a reflection of Dean's artistic evolution, moving from the more upbeat vibes of her earlier work to a place where stillness and contemplation take center stage. This shift is significant; it mirrors a growing desire for peace amidst the chaos of modern life.

Musical Elements Enhancing Visuals

The production choices in "Float" further enhance its serene imagery. Soft instrumentation and gentle melodies create a sound that feels like a warm embrace. The subtle layering of harmonies adds depth, making the listener feel as if they are being cradled in a serene environment. This careful crafting of sound complements Dean's lyrical imagery perfectly.

Incorporating elements of R&B and pop, Dean avoids the pitfalls of overproduction, allowing the emotional weight of her voice to shine through. This is particularly evident in moments where the instrumentation fades, leaving her vocals bare and vulnerable, creating an intimate space for reflection.
